Klaviyo, a leading customer data and marketing automation platform, today announced that Jennifer Ceran has joined its board of directors. This comes on the heels of Klaviyo's $320 million Series D funding announcement earlier this month, which brought the company's valuation to $9.15 billion on a pre-money basis. Her appointment follows the additions of Kim Hammonds and Tony Weisman, who both joined the board in January.
